Freeman Reservoir Campground

Craig, CO
Freeman Reservoir Campground is a non-reservable campground located near Freeman Reservoir in Craig, Colorado. The campground offers 18 campsites with pull-through and back-in options, vault toilets, potable water, and garbage services. Corrals and horse trailer parking are available. Sawmill Creek Campground

Craig, CO
Sawmill Creek Campground is a decommissioned campground that is open to dispersed use. There are no facilities or services, and visitors should be prepared to pack out everything that they pack in. The campground is located in the Medicine Bow-Routt National Forests & Thunder Basin National Grassland. It is a great spot for dispersed camping.
